God promised Israel that they would lend to many nations but would borrow from none. For most of us in the 21st century this is a completely foreign concept. When every influence around us tells us that living in debt is “normal” and is even glamorized, it is no wonder that we tend to believe this is the way it has to be. But God has more for our finances than the world believes is possible. And it starts with stretching our faith that God is able to do the miraculous in our financial lives.
